Title: SCOTS OF TOMORROW

Reference number: 0007

Date: 1950s,c

Sponsor: Joint Production Committee of SEFA and SFC

Production company: Campbell Harper Films Ltd.

Sound: sound

Original format: 35mm

Colour: bw

Fiction: non-fiction

Running time: 13.00 mins

Description: Scottish school pupils studying scientific and historical projects.

Shortened version of LEARNING FOR LIVING. See ref. 0416. Paper Archive 1/6/38 File containing correspondence.

Credits: w. Albert Mackie
nar. Ian Gilmour

Shotlist: REEL I

Credits (.07); Schoolchildren experimenting with air balloons (.45); General shots of a typical Scottish school and its activities. Assembly, historical visits and projects, prefects' meeting, recreation, domestic science and project classes (7.26).

REEL II

No credits. Shots of various activities: arts and crafts, carpentry, nature study and educational visits (5.04)
